What is a Kilonewton?

The Kilonewton (kN) is a unit of force equal to 1,000 newtons. It is commonly used in safety specifications for climbing equipment and in civil engineering.

What is a Petanewton?

The Petanewton (PN) is a unit of force equal to one quadrillion newtons.

How to Convert Kilonewton to Petanewton

To convert Kilonewton to Petanewton, multiply the Kilonewton value by 1e-12.

PN = kN × 1e-12
